名词 n.
  1. A scan from the back or rear side. countable,rare,uncountable
动词 v.
  1. To scan something from the back or rear side. rare,transitive
    — If at any stage it is impossible to make the required allocation of a node or line, or after the last E-word to find other realisations with the same mesh point 1, the control stream is backscanned by the interpreter to the first significant new allocation and the forward scan restarted.
